Transaction 526623fd85d3e60fb698c8e0902cb58b13e343e366608efbccf1dc95da5e9d2d

1 Input
2 Outputs
  • 526623fd85d3e60fb698c8e0902cb58b13e343e366608efbccf1dc95da5e9d2d:0
  • value  290529
    address  17Z5SbSQ7BjcXGfd3pNW34RpytWx3big5o
  • 526623fd85d3e60fb698c8e0902cb58b13e343e366608efbccf1dc95da5e9d2d:1
  • value  1904642
    address  1F9gih4wD8TYecbpGAqQ3Ep18uyLKFVdLr